Leidos is seeking a Software/Controls Engineer CO-OP to be based in Walled Lake, Michigan. Candidates will work directly with the technical teams working mainly to develop building management software for large scale industrial clients. The position includes programing with Microsoft .NET, databases, operating systems, web programming, networks, and Microsoft Office. Employees will gain experience with general programming, design, and testing methodologies.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ES:
Leidos’ Software/Controls Engineer CO-OPs work on team projects under an engineer’s supervision. CO-OPs will be involved with the design, programming, testing, and implementation of projects.

Leidos’ software engineer CO-OPs work on team projects under an engineer’s supervision. CO-OPs will be involved with the design, programming, testing, and implementation of projects. Programming will be a requirement of the position (.Net, VB. ASP, Java, basic, C++, etc.).

BASIC QUALIFICATIONS:
•Pursuing a Bachelor's Degree Computer Engineering, or related field. Minimum GPA 3.0.
•Candidates should be computer literate with a basic understanding of software development.
•The candidate should also possess the ability to break down large tasks into smaller pieces and handle multiple tasks simultaneously.
•Some travel is required.
•U.S. Citizenship is required.
